U.S., July 25 -- ClinicalTrials.gov registry received information related to the study (NCT07724470) titled 'Effects of Myokinetic Stretching Technique and Post Facilitation Stretching on Pain, Range of Motion, and Functional Disability in Patients With Cervical Radicular Pain' on July 09.
Brief Summary: Cervical radicular pain (CRP) is a musculoskeletal condition characterized by neck pain radiating to the upper limb due to compression or irritation of cervical nerve roots. It significantly affects daily activities, cervical mobility, and overall quality of life.
